규칙

Bazel 생태계에는 널리 사용되는 언어와 패키지를 지원하기 위한 규칙이 지속적으로 증가하고 있습니다. Bazel의 강점은 다른 개발자가 사용할 수 있는 새 규칙을 정의하는 능력에서 시작됩니다.

이 페이지에서는 권장, 기본, 비 기본 Bazel 규칙을 설명합니다.

권장되는 규칙은 다음과 같습니다.

저장소 Skylib에는 새 규칙과 새 매크로를 작성할 때 유용한 추가 함수가 포함되어 있습니다.

위 규칙을 검토했으며 권장 규칙 요구사항을 준수했습니다. 문제 및 기능 요청과 관련하여 각 규칙 세트의 유지관리 담당자에게 문의하세요.

Bazel 규칙을 더 찾으려면 검색엔진을 사용하거나 awesomebazel.com을 살펴보거나 GitHub에서 검색하세요.

특정 프로그래밍 언어에 적용되지 않는 네이티브 규칙

네이티브 규칙은 Bazel 바이너리와 함께 제공되므로 load 문 없이 BUILD 파일에서 항상 사용할 수 있습니다.

기본이 아닌 삽입된 규칙

Bazel은 Starlark로 작성된 추가 규칙도 삽입합니다. 이러한 저장소는 @bazel_tools 내장 외부 저장소에서 로드할 수 있습니다.